Highlights

This tour combines the cultural highlights of Lalibela with hiking in beautiful nature with stunning views of the Lasta Mountains. The surrounding area of Lalibela offers superb hiking, including Abune Josef Mountain, the third highest peak in Ethiopia. Nestled on a plateau, Lalibela Hudad is a world in itself. The Hudad Lodge is a great place to stay and use as a base to explore the area. A hidden Eden with great views and a superb variety of animals, birds, and plant life. Accessible only by foot, community-run, built in traditional style with local materials, solar powered, and all waste products recycled, the lodge showcases local sustainable and ecological tourism at its’ best.
Nowhere else can you find the form of rock churches so typical of Ethiopia in this concentration and quality as in Lalibela. A play of light and shadow, color and shape, often referred to by many as one of the "Living Wonders of the World," will keep you amazed.

Lalibela – Hudada-Lasta Mountains
  • Asheton Maryam Monastery

    2 hoursAdmission Ticket Included
    Early in the morning, you will drive up to Asheton Mariam, which is ruggedly carved out of a cleft on the cliffs of Asheten. The monastery is between the historic Ethiopian town of Lalibela and the Hudad Eco-Lodge. Built in the 11th century, King Lalibela’s original plan was to build the rock-hewn churches in Asheten Maryam. The setting of the monastery is particularly riveting, with 360-degree views of the valley and town.

Hudada-Lasta Mountains
  • Mount Abuna Yosef

    9 hoursAdmission Ticket Free
    Today, for those who want, we will have a strenuous hike up to Abuna Josef Mountain (4260 m), which should not be underestimated. But it is a great hike, and you will be rewarded with extraordinary views and the chance to see the unique afro-alpine habitat zone with its’ majestic giant lobelias. You might be lucky enough to see the endangered Ethiopian wolf. You will have coffee in the local tukul's house and enjoy the social lives of the farmers.
  • Hudad

    2 hoursAdmission Ticket Free
    As an alternative, you can visit the nearby Abichagula Reserve, which is located on the northern side of the Hudad, and take one of the many short walks. The reserve is home to large numbers of endemic fauna and flora and is one of the few remaining examples of thick wild vegetation. In addition, the mysterious and as of yet unexplored buried church of Beta Gabriel is a two-hour hike from the Lodge.
